Understanding Quantum Computing and Its Applications

The Basics of Quantum Computing At the core of quantum computing lies the concept of superposition and entanglement. Superposition allows qubits to exist in multiple states simultaneously, enabling parallel computations. Entanglement, on the other hand, links the states of multiple qubits, allowing for correlations that classical computers cannot achieve. Quantum Gates and Algorithms Quantum gates are the building blocks of quantum circuits. These gates manipulate the quantum states of qubits to perform computations. Some of the most fundamental quantum gates include the Hadamard gate, Pauli gates (X, Y, Z), and the controlled-NOT (CNOT) gate. By combining these gates, complex quantum algorithms can be designed. One of the most well-known quantum algorithms is Shor’s algorithm, which efficiently factors large numbers. This algorithm has significant implications for cryptography and poses a potential threat to the security of many existing encryption methods. Another notable quantum algorithm is Grover’s algorithm, which accelerates the search of unstructured databases, offering a quadratic speedup compared to classical algorithms. Applications of Quantum Computing Cryptography and Security: Quantum computing has the potential to break current cryptographic systems based on factorization and discrete logarithm problems. However, it also offers the opportunity to develop quantum-resistant cryptographic algorithms that can withstand attacks from quantum computers. Optimization and Simulation: Quantum computing can solve optimization problems more efficiently, allowing for better resource allocation, route planning, and supply chain management. It also holds promise for simulating complex physical systems, such as molecular interactions, which could advance drug discovery and material science. Machine Learning and Data Analysis: Quantum machine learning algorithms can harness the power of quantum computing to process and analyze large datasets more effectively, leading to improved pattern recognition, data clustering, and classification. Financial Modeling and Portfolio Optimization: Quantum computing can assist in complex financial modeling tasks, enabling faster risk analysis, portfolio optimization, and option pricing. Quantum Chemistry: Quantum simulations can aid in the understanding of chemical reactions, catalyst design, and the discovery of new materials with desired properties. Quantum Communication: Quantum cryptography allows for secure communication channels, where the principles of quantum mechanics ensure the confidentiality and integrity of information transmission. Challenges and Future Prospects Despite the tremendous potential of quantum computing, there are significant challenges to overcome. Quantum systems are highly susceptible to errors due to environmental noise and decoherence. Building stable and scalable quantum computers with low error rates remains a significant technical hurdle. However, ongoing research and advancements in hardware, software, and error correction techniques are steadily pushing the boundaries of quantum computing. The development of fault-tolerant quantum computers could unleash the full potential of this technology, paving the way for even more groundbreaking applications.
